AI Obstacle Avoidance

The most effective robot vacuums are equipped with sensors that aid them in avoiding obstacles and navigate the home. They include distance sensors that emit laser beams and measure the time it takes for the light to bounce off furniture and walls to create a map of the space. This allows the robot to detect and steer clear of objects, which ensures a non-collision cleaning process.

Other robots use 3D Time of Flight imaging to identify and scan for obstacles. This technology is also utilized in smart home cameras. It works by sending out a series of light pulses that are then examined to determine the height, depth, and dimensions of objects. It is less accurate than some other mapping technologies and could be unable to distinguish transparent or reflective surfaces.

Some robotic vacuum cleaner comparison cleaners additionally, in addition to using traditional sensors to identify and avoid obstacles, employ advanced AI. ECOVACS robots for example feature AIVI 3D which can accurately detect obstacles and provide an easy, accident-free cleaning process. This advanced software can even operate in darkness which allows users to have an uncluttered home at night or while watching TV.

Robotic cleaners are also able to avoid obstacles using monocular and binocular vision. They take pictures and analyze them before determining what they are. This feature helps the robot avoid hitting objects such as furniture legs or toys, and may save you from a lot of trouble. This kind of obstacle detection isn't as effective as lasers or 3-D imaging. It could cause the robot to become stuck under furniture, or missing areas of the room.

Suction Power

Suction power is measured in Pascals. It is the force which holds the bristles of the robot to the floor. This lets them grab dirt and direct it into the dustbin. Before purchasing a product it is important to assess your cleaning needs and then compare models based on their suction power.

For most homes with an assortment of hard and soft flooring, a minimum pressure of 2,500 Pa will suffice. For carpets that are primarily used opt for models that are high-end with up to 11,000 Pa of power to ensure effective whole-home deep cleaning.

Most budget-friendly robotics have one or more rotors which create a vacuum-like suction to draw dirt, hair and other particles from the floor into its dust bin. These models are best suited to vacuuming hard floors and low-pile area rugs. The more expensive models include additional brushes that do not tangle to get into crevices and corners.

If you have different types of flooring in your home, choose one that has multiple suction levels. These will automatically adapt to the type of surface. This allows you adjust the suction levels based on your needs and protects your flooring from damage.

Another method of reducing the amount of dust that accumulates inside your robot vacuum is to select an auto-emptying model that has a large dustbin. These units empty the dustbins inside the unit after every cleaning cycle, preventing accumulation of tangled fibers and other particles that can affect the efficiency of the unit.

Be aware that although the higher suction power usually requires more time for each cleaning session, they also gobble up debris quicker, filling their trash bins more frequently. As such, it's crucial to weigh the pros and cons of cleaning performance and the battery's runtime, noise and frequency of dust bin filling.
